As a leader in e-commerce, Amazon is building an authoritative knowledge base for every product in the world. With hundreds of millions of customers and billions of products, Amazon will offer a challenging but fun journey to turn this big and rapidly changing data into high-quality knowledge to impact customer experiences across Amazon.

As a member of the product knowledge team, based in NYC, you will play a key role in the establishment of a new platform, with opportunities to create enormous benefit for our customers and Amazon. You will take academic research from theory to production implementation by overcoming performance, scalability, and resiliency challenges. You should enjoy optimization through rapid experimentation, have extremely high standards, and strong ability to implement in the face of ambiguity. Expertise in specialized areas such as Machine Learning, Natural Language Processing, Text Mining, Graph Processing, Search, or Recommendation Systems is desired.

Basic Qualifications


· Programming experience with at least one modern language such as Java, C++, or C# including object-oriented design
· 1+ years of experience contributing to the architecture and design (architecture, design patterns, reliability and scaling) of new and current systems.
· 2+ years of non-internship professional software development experience


Preferred Qualifications

· Master’s deg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ering or related technical discipline.
· A deep understanding of software development in a team, and a track record of shipping software on time
· Exceptional customer relationship skills including the ability to discover the true requirements underlying feature requests, recommend alternative technical and business approaches, and lead engineering efforts to meet aggressive timelines with optimal solutions.
· Deep hands-on technical expertise building data pipelines, experience with AWS EMR, Athena, Sagemaker
· Experience in big data processing like Apache Spark
· Excellent verbal and written communication skills
